Zitsanzo za Mafunso Okhudza Kuchuluka kwa Oxidation ndi Kuchepetsa

Pendauluan

Kusungunuka ndi kuchepetsa ndi mfundo zazikulu mu chemistry zomwe zimalumikizana komanso sizingalekanitsidwe. Njirazi zimachitika nthawi imodzi mu reaction yotchedwa redox reaction (oxidation-reduction reaction). Mu reaction iyi, chinthu chomwe chimachitika mu oxidation chimatulutsa ma elekitironi, pomwe chinthu chomwe chimachitika mu reduction chimapeza ma elekitironi. Chitsanzo cha Funso 1

Funso:
Dziwani zinthu zomwe zimadutsa mu okosijeni ndikuchepetsa zotsatirazi:
\[ 2Mg(s) + O_2(g) \rightarrow 2MgO(s) \]

Kukambirana:
Kuti tidziwe zinthu zomwe zimadutsa mu okosijeni ndi kuchepetsedwa, tiyenera kuyang'ana kusintha kwa chiwerengero cha okosijeni cha chinthu chilichonse mu reaction.

1. Manambala a okosijeni mu chophatikiza choyambirira:
– Magnesium (Mg) ndi chinthu chaulere chomwe chili mu mawonekedwe olimba, kotero nambala yake ya okosijeni ndi 0.
– Mpweya wa okosijeni (O₂) mu mawonekedwe a mamolekyu a mpweya (g) ndi chinthu chaulere, kotero nambala yake ya okosijeni ndi 0.

2. Manambala a okosijeni mu mankhwala opangidwa:
– Magnesium mu magnesium oxide (MgO) ili ndi chiwerengero cha okosijeni cha +2 (Mg²⁺).
– Mpweya wa okosijeni mu magnesium oxide (MgO) uli ndi chiwerengero cha okosijeni cha -2 (O²⁻).

3. Kusintha kwa chiwerengero cha okosijeni:
– Magnesium imasintha kuchoka pa 0 kufika pa +2. Izi zikutanthauza kuti magnesium yakhala ikuwonjezeka mu kuchuluka kwa okosijeni, kapena yakhala ikusungunuka.
– Mpweya wa okosijeni umasintha kuchoka pa 0 kufika pa -2. Izi zikutanthauza kuti mpweya wachepa mu kuchuluka kwa okosijeni, kapena wachepa.

Pomaliza:
– Magnesium (Mg) ndi chinthu chomwe chimapangidwa ndi okosijeni.
– Mpweya (O₂) ndi chinthu chomwe chimachepetsedwa.

Chitsanzo cha Funso 2

Funso:
Dziwani chothandizira kuoxidation ndi chothandizira kuchepetsa muzotsatirazi:
\[ Zn + CuSO_4 \kumanja ZnSO_4 + Cu \]

Kukambirana:
Mu izi, tidzadziwa amene wasungunuka ndi amene wachepetsedwa, komanso kuzindikira wowonjezera kutentha ndi wochepetsa kutentha.

1. Zoyambitsa:
– Zn (s): Nambala ya okosijeni = 0.
- Cu mu CuSO₄: Nambala ya okosijeni = +2.

2. Zogulitsa:
– Zn mu ZnSO₄: Nambala ya okosijeni = +2.
– Cu (s): Nambala ya okosijeni = 0.

3. Kusintha kwa Manambala a Oxidation:
– Zn imasintha kuchoka pa 0 kufika pa +2. Izi zikutanthauza kuti Zn imakumana ndi kuwonjezeka kwa chiwerengero cha okosijeni, kapena imakumana ndi okosijeni.
– Cu imasintha kuchoka pa +2 kufika pa 0. Izi zikutanthauza kuti Cu imachepa mu chiwerengero cha okosijeni, kapena imachepetsedwa.

4. Zinthu Zopangitsa Kuti Zinthu Zizisungunuka ndi Zinthu Zochepetsa Kuchuluka kwa Mafuta:
– Chothandizira kuoxidation ndi chinthu chomwe chimayambitsa chinthu china kuti chiwonjezeke, ndipo chimachepa chokha. Mu izi, Cu²⁺ mu CuSO₄ imayambitsa Zn kuti iwonjezeke, kotero Cu²⁺ ndiye chothandizira kuoxidation.
– Chochepetsa ndi chinthu chomwe chimapangitsa kuti chinthu china chichepe, ndipo chimasungunuka ndi okosijeni. Mu izi, Zn imapangitsa kuti Cu²⁺ ichepe, kotero Zn ndi chochepetsa.

Pomaliza:
– Chothandizira kuoxidation ndi Cu²⁺ mu CuSO₄.
- Wothandizira kuchepetsa ndi Zn.

Chitsanzo cha Funso 3

Funso:
Werengani manambala a okosijeni a zinthu zomwe zili mu mankhwala otsatirawa:
\[ H_2SO_4 \]

Kukambirana:
Kuti tidziwe kuchuluka kwa okosijeni wa chinthu chilichonse mu sulfuric acid (H₂SO₄), timagwiritsa ntchito malamulo odziwira kuchuluka kwa okosijeni.

1. Hydrojeni (H) mu mankhwala nthawi zambiri imakhala ndi chiwerengero cha okosijeni cha +1.
2. Mpweya wa okosijeni (O) m'zinthu nthawi zambiri umakhala ndi chiwerengero cha okosijeni cha -2.
3. Chiwerengero chonse cha manambala a okosijeni mu mankhwala osalowerera ndale chiyenera kukhala 0.

Tsopano tikuwerengera:
– Haidrojeni: maatomu 2 a H iliyonse +1, chiwerengero chonse (+1) 2 = +2.
– Mpweya: 4 O maatomu aliwonse -2, chiwerengero chonse (-2) 4 = -8.
– Sulfure: Tiyerekeze kuti nambala ya okosijeni S = x.

Chiwerengero chonse cha manambala a okosijeni:
\[ 2(+1) + x + 4(-2) = 0 \]
\[ 2 + x – 8 = 0 \]
\[x – 6 = 0 \]
\[x = +6 \]

Pomaliza:
– Nambala ya okosijeni H = +1
– Nambala ya okosijeni O = -2
– Nambala ya okosijeni S = +6

Chitsanzo cha Funso 4

Funso:
Mu reaction yotsatirayi, dziwani nambala ya okosijeni ya chinthu chilichonse, ndipo dziwani theka la reaction ya redox iyi:
\[ MnO_4^- + 8H^+ + 5Fe^{2+} \kumanja Mn^{2+} + 4H_2O + 5Fe^{3+} \]

Kukambirana:
1. Dziwani nambala ya okosijeni:
– Mn mu MnO₄⁻ : Nambala ya okosijeni ya Mn ndi +7. (Chifukwa O = -2 mu maatomu 4 O: (-2) 4 = -8; Ioni yofanana ya MnO₄⁻ = -1; Chifukwa chake Mn iyenera kukhala +7 kuti pakhale kufanana: +7 – 8 = -1).
– Fe mu Fe²⁺: Nambala ya okosijeni ya Fe ndi +2.
– Mn mu Mn²⁺: Nambala ya okosijeni ya Mn ndi +2.
– Fe mu Fe³⁺: Nambala ya okosijeni ya Fe ndi +3.
– Mpweya mu H₂O: Nambala ya okosijeni ya O ndi -2.
– Haidrojeni mu H₂O: Nambala ya okosijeni ya H ndi +1.

2. Dziwani theka la yankho:
– Kuyankha kwa okosijeni (Fe²⁺ imasintha kukhala Fe³⁺):
\[ Fe^{2+} \rightarrow Fe^{3+} + e^- \]

– Kuchepetsa kwa mphamvu (MnO₄⁻ kupita ku Mn²⁺):
\[ MnO_4^- + 8H^+ + 5e^- \kumanja Mn^{2+} + 4H_2O \]

Pomaliza:
– Chiwerengero cha okosijeni cha Mn mu MnO₄⁻ ndi +7.
– Nambala ya okosijeni ya Fe mu Fe²⁺ ndi +2.
– Chiwerengero cha okosijeni cha Fe mu Fe³⁺ ndi +3.
